How they compare

Bangladesh currently reports 222,888 t against 199,869 t in Mexico, a difference of 23,019 t.

That makes Bangladesh's figure about 1.1 times Mexico's.

The two have swapped places 9 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Mexico ahead.

Bangladesh ranks 17th and Mexico ranks 19th of 201 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Bangladesh averaged higher in 1 and Mexico in 6.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bangladesh Mexico Difference Ahead
1960s 54,984 t 78,278 t 23,294 t Mexico
1970s 62,935 t 98,869 t 35,934 t Mexico
1980s 82,130 t 129,945 t 47,815 t Mexico
1990s 99,855 t 141,249 t 41,394 t Mexico
2000s 139,613 t 163,855 t 24,242 t Mexico
2010s 187,674 t 188,371 t 696.8 t Mexico
2020s 214,186 t 200,230 t 13,955 t Bangladesh

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
